About Realizing Increased Photosynthetic Efficiency (RIPE) Project
Realizing Increased Photosynthetic Efficiency (RIPE) is an international research project that is engineering plants to photosynthesize more efficiently to increase crop yields. By sustainably increasing the productivity of staple food crops, the project aims to reduce hunger and poverty for farming families in Sub-Saharan Africa and Southeast Asia.
